About the role
- Develop engineering design packages, specifications, and bid documents.
- Create models, simulations, and prototypes to validate concepts.
- Apply engineering principles to evaluate safety, cost, reliability, and constructability.
- Support permitting, materials selection, and readiness reviews.
- Visit hydro facilities to scope future projects and support active construction.
- Communicate with site leadership to align project work with plant operations.
- Monitor installation quality, safety, and adherence to design specifications.
- Troubleshoot issues and resolve technical challenges in real time.
- Coordinate project schedules, budgets, contractors, and deliverables.
- Use SAP and scheduling tools (Primavera P6 or MS Project) to track progress.
- Lead kickoff meetings, provide status updates, and manage documentation through closeout.
- Investigate root-cause issues and implement corrective actions.
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in Mechanical, Electrical Controls, or Civil/Structural Engineering from an ABET-accredited university
- Minimum 2 years of engineering experience (hydro or industrial)
- Valid driver's license
- Experience with SAP (work management), Primavera P6 or MS Project, and Bluebeam
- Hydro industry familiarity (6+ months) is a bonus.
